Govt can suspend channels' ads over non-payment of salaries: Pemra chairman -

KARACHI: Pakistan Electronic Media Regulatory Authority (Pemra) Chairman Mirza Saleem Baig has said the government has the power to suspend advertisements of TV channels that do not pay salaries to their employees under the new Pemra rules. Talking to The News, the chairman Pemra said that media workers could file complaints with the authority, if ....

AEMEND urges govt not to withdraw Pemra bill -

LAHORE: The Association of Electronic Media Editors and News Directors (AEMEND) has demanded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if and Federal Minister for Information Marriyum Aurengzeb to make necessary amendments to the Pemra Act instead of withdrawing the bill. In a press statement issued by AMEND, which was also tweeted by the organisation, it demanded that the ....

PBA welcomes amendments to Pemra Act 2023 -

ISLAMABAD: The Pakistan Broadcasters Association (PBA) has welcomed amendments to the Pemra Act 2023 and specially referred to the industry’s long-standing issues of defining fake news, AGAR, delay in payment of salaries to employees, rationalization of FM Radio/Television renewal fee, relaxation in restrictions on advertising limits, etc. A press release, issued by PBA Executive Director ....
